原文:List集合的三種遍歷方式的效率問題

如果看完覺得對您有幫助到,麻煩關注一下,您的關注是我繼續更新的動力。謝謝 第一種:迭代器遍歷 for Iterator lt String gt it list.iterator it.hasNext .... 這種方式在循環執行過程中會進行數據鎖定,性能稍差,同時如果你想在循環過程中去掉某個元素,只能調用it.remove方法,不能使用list.remove方法,否則一定出現並發訪問的錯誤。 ...

2017-02-07 09:32 0 4407 推薦指數:

查看詳情

Java的List集合三種遍歷方式

  List集合在Java日常開發中是必不可少的,要懂得運用各種各樣的方法可以大大提高我們開發的效率,當然是要在對應的需求上使用合適的方法才會事半功倍。   List集合:     List<Example> exampleList = new ArrayList<> ...

Sun Jun 18 21:51:00 CST 2017 0 49936
三種List集合遍歷方式

首先我們來建一個簡單的實體類:(素材來源於:https://www.cnblogs.com/lianoulay/p/8849747.html) 第一、最基礎的遍歷方式:for循環,指定下標長度,使用List集合的size()方法,進行for循環遍歷 ...

Fri Sep 20 18:10:00 CST 2019 0 3771
Java中List集合三種遍歷方式

假設變量 list 是需要循環遍歷的變量 第一、最基礎的遍歷方式:for循環,指定下標長度 第二、較為簡潔的遍歷方式:使用foreach遍歷List三種、適用迭代器Iterator遍歷:直接根據List集合的自動遍歷 ...

Mon Mar 30 00:04:00 CST 2020 0 766
List集合遍歷方式

List集合遍歷方式 1、Iterator接口 —— java集合中一員 (1)包:java.util.Iterator (2)功能:主要用於迭代訪問(遍歷)Collection中的元素 ​ Iterator對象稱為迭代器 (3)方法: ​ public E next():返回 ...

Thu Aug 06 23:05:00 CST 2020 0 3910
遍歷List集合三種方法

List<String> list = new ArrayList<String>();list.add("aaa");list.add("bbb");list.add("ccc");方法一:超級for循環遍歷for(String attribute : list ...

Tue Aug 16 06:26:00 CST 2016 0 350065
java中遍歷集合三種方式

集合遍歷操作的三種方式 Iterator迭代器方式 增強for循環 普通for循環 代碼如下: ...

Wed Jul 10 17:48:00 CST 2019 0 4873
Collection集合三種遍歷方式

package cn.itcast_01; import java.util.ArrayList; import java.util.Iterator; /* * ArrayList存儲字符串並遍歷。要求加入泛型,並用增強for遍歷 ...

Sun Dec 23 19:58:00 CST 2018 0 1239
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M